Suppose the two numbers are x and y so xy = 3000
the HCF = 10
we know that product of two numbers = product of their HCF and LCM
XY = HCF * LCM
3000 = 10 * LCM
3000/10 = LCM
300 = LCM
Answer 300
Q12 : Let us say second number is x so
product of x and 160 = product of HCF and LCM of ( x and 160 )
160 x = 32 * 1760
x= 32 * 1760 / 160
x= 352
Answer : 352
